EDITORS COMMENTS
This photograph showcases a remarkable Japanese wooden drum in the shape of a fish, known as Mokugyo. Dating back to approximately 1889 during the late Edo period, this exquisite artifact holds great significance in Buddhist temple ceremonies. The craftsmanship and attention to detail are evident as one gazes upon its intricate design. The Mokugyo drum is an essential instrument used in Buddhist rituals, symbolizing enlightenment and awakening. Its fish-like form represents freedom and transformation within the spiritual realm. As it resonates with deep vibrations when struck by a hammer, it creates a rhythmic sound that reverberates throughout the temple, enveloping worshippers in its sacred aura.
